A parallelogram MNQR has vertices M(4, -6), N(10, 2), Q(8, 16) and R(x, y). Find the coordinates of R.
Explanation
(overrightarrow{MN} = overrightarrow{RQ})
(begin{pmatrix} 4 – 10 \ – 6 – 2 end{pmatrix} = begin{pmatrix} x – 8 \ y – 16 end{pmatrix})
(implies 4 – 10 = x – 8)
(-6 = x – 8 implies x = -6 + 8 = 2)
(implies – 6 – 2 = y – 16)
(-8 = y – 16 implies y = -8 + 16 = 8)
The coordinate of R is (2, 8).
